Abstract
本发明公开了一种具有促进伤口愈合功效的医用敷料,由下列主要原料制备而成,均为重量份:聚氨酯25-35;骨碎补4-8;黄芪5-9;岩笋6-11;细辛6-9;甘草10-14;陆英8-12;虎杖7-11;积雪草5-9;川芎6-9;荆芥10-12;聚乙烯醇9-13;醋酸淀粉酯6-10。本发明的优良效果还表现在:本发明所得医用敷料将聚氨酯与传统中草药相结合,配方合理,配伍精准,对创口无刺激性,有促进上皮长入,加速伤口愈合的作用。

技术领域
本发明涉及医用材料领域,特别是涉及一种具有促进伤口愈合功效的医用敷料及制法。
背景技术
皮肤是人体的重要器官,具有十分重要的物理、化学及生物屏障功能,起着防止水分及电解质等物质的流失,以及免疫、传感等功能,对维持体内环境的稳定和阻止微生物入侵起着十分重要的作用。由于创伤、烧伤及皮肤溃烂等原因引起的皮肤损伤,会引起机体一系列的问题,比如细菌感染、新陈代谢加剧、水分和蛋白质过度流失、内分泌及免疫系统功能失调等,严重的可能危及生命。因此,皮肤损伤后,通常需要采用皮肤的替代品医用敷料来保护伤口,防止创面感染和严重脱水,提供有利于伤口愈合的湿润环境,促进创面愈合。
目前传统敷料如医用脱脂棉纱布、棉垫和凡士林纱布等,是临床上皮肤创伤应用最广的敷料。传统敷料具有网状编织结构,其价格低廉、制作工艺相对简单、原料来源广泛、质地柔软,有较强的吸收能力,能防止创面渗液积聚,对创面愈合有一定程度的保护作用,至今仍在皮肤创伤中广泛应用。但是传统敷料也有很明显的缺点,比如不能保持创面湿润,延迟创面愈合;创面肉芽组织容易长人敷料的网眼中,更换敷料时易与创面伤口粘连,损伤新生的肉芽组织并引起疼痛;敷料渗透后屏障作用差,容易引起外源性感染,止血效果差。
自20世纪50年代,聚氨酯首次应用于生物医学上算起,40多年来,聚氨酯弹性体在医学上的用途日益厂泛。1958年,聚氨酯首次用于骨折修复材料,而后又成功地应用于血管外科手术缝合用补充涂层。20世纪70年代开始,聚氯酯作为一种医用材料已倍受重视。到了20世纪80年代,用聚氨酯弹性体制造人工心脏移植手术获得成功,使聚氨酯材料在生物医学上的应用得到进一步的发展。目前在医学上,特别是在制造植入人体的各种医疗用品方面有着广泛的用途,应用领域包括人工心脏瓣膜、人工肺、骨粘合剂、人工皮肤与烧伤敷料、心脏起博器导线、缝线等。
申请公布号CN105079857A(申请号201510521449.7)的中国发明专利文献公开了一种聚氨酯泡沫敷料,由以下重量配比的原料配制而成:聚醚多元醇100克,一缩乙二醇8克-10克,咪唑催化剂0.7克-1.0克,硅油稳定剂1克-2克,硼砂3克-5克,水2克-3克,海藻酸钙10克-15克。申请公布号CN105056279A(申请号201510490782.6)的中国发明专利文献公开了一种复合胶原的聚氨酯基双层敷料,包括内层胶原复合亲水性聚氨酯泡沫敷料和外层聚氨酯薄膜通过医用压敏胶粘接。所述胶原复合亲水性聚氨酯泡沫敷料由以下质量百分比计的组分混合后发泡而成:聚氨酯预聚物40-80%,起泡剂10-50%,交联剂5-40%,胶原蛋白0.1-3%。所述聚氨酯预聚物由0.1-1mol的聚醚多元醇与1-3mol的二异氰酸酯反应而得。申请公布号CN104906624A(申请号201510254239.6)的中国发明专利文献公开了一种复合海绵医用敷料及其制备方法,由以下重量份的原料配制而成:乙基纤维素50-70份,改性海蜇胶原粉体10-25份,桧木醇10-25份,壳聚糖10-25份,海藻酸钠5-15份,硫代硫酸钠15-30份,儿茶素1-10份,增粘剂4-16份,偶联剂0.1-10份及水50-80份。
伤口愈合问题始终与外科学的发展相伴随,现有的医用敷料对创面愈合无促进作用,无保湿作用,肉芽组织容易长入纱布网眼中致粘连结痂,且敷料渗透时易导致外源性感染等,难以满足患者的要求。
发明内容
为了弥补上述不足,本发明的目的在于提供一种具有促进伤口愈合功效的医用敷料,在药力渗透、透气性、促进伤口愈合等方面具有显著优势,且制备成本低、制备工艺简单等。
本发明的技术方案是:
一种具有促进伤口愈合功效的医用敷料,由下列主要原料制备而成,均为重量份:聚氨酯25-35;骨碎补4-8;黄芪5-9;岩笋6-11;细辛6-9;甘草10-14;陆英8-12;虎杖7-11;积雪草5-9;川芎6-9;荆芥10-12;聚乙烯醇9-13;醋酸淀粉酯6-10。
优选的方案是:聚氨酯28-32;骨碎补5-7;黄芪6-8;岩笋7-10;细辛7-8;甘草11-13;陆英9-11;虎杖8-10;积雪草6-8;川芎7-8;荆芥10.5-11.5;聚乙烯醇10-12;醋酸淀粉酯7-9。
更加优选的是:聚氨酯30;骨碎补6;黄芪7;岩笋8.5;细辛7.5;甘草12;陆英10;虎杖9;积雪草7;川芎7.5;荆芥11;聚乙烯醇11;醋酸淀粉酯8。
一种具有促进伤口愈合功效的医用敷料的制备方法,步骤如下:
(1)将虎杖、骨碎补和细辛置于容器中,加入白酒浸泡,每天摇动2-6次(优选每天摇动3-5次),过滤,滤液回收乙醇,得药液,备用;
(2)将步骤(1)所得药渣与黄芪、岩笋、甘草、陆英、积雪草、川芎和荆芥混合,置于药锅内,加二次蒸馏水,文火煎煮两次,第一次煎煮33-53分钟(优选第一次煎煮37-49分钟),第二次煎煮20-36分钟(优选第二次煎煮24-32分钟),合并两次煎液,过滤,滤液与步骤(1)所得药液混合,减压浓缩至75℃相对密度为1.18-1.20的清膏,加入香油拌匀,制成中药油膏,备用;
(3)将聚氨酯溶于DMF中配制成浓度为20%-40%的聚氨酯溶液(优选配制成浓度为25%-35%的聚氨酯溶液),置于三颈瓶中,向溶液中加入聚乙烯醇和醋酸淀粉酯,于恒温水浴锅中,沿顺时针磁力搅拌1-2小时(优选沿顺时针磁力搅拌1.2-1.8小时),得混合溶液,备用;
(4)向步骤(3)所得混合溶液中加入步骤(2)所得中药油膏、消泡剂、抗菌剂及透皮吸收剂,混匀,得铸膜液,备用;
(5)将步骤(4)所得铸膜液倒入平板玻璃板上,均匀刮制成膜,静置8-15分钟(优选静置10-13分钟),然后平行放入清水中凝胶45-65分钟(优选平行放入清水中凝胶50-60分钟),取出,置于浓度为0.2%羟丙甲基纤维素水溶液中浸泡10-24分钟(优选浸泡14-20分钟),取出,冷冻干燥,灭菌,封装,即得。
上述一种具有促进伤口愈合功效的医用敷料的制备方法,优选的方案是,步骤(1)中白酒的量为所述原料药量的3.8-5.6倍(优选的白酒的量为所述原料药量的4.4-5.0倍,更加优选的白酒的量为所述原料药量的4.7倍)。
上述一种具有促进伤口愈合功效的医用敷料的制备方法,优选的方案是,步骤(1)中浸泡的时间为3-7天(优选的浸泡的时间为4-6天,更加优选的浸泡的时间为5天)。
上述一种具有促进伤口愈合功效的医用敷料的制备方法,优选的方案是,步骤(3)中恒温水浴的温度为50℃-80℃(优选的恒温水浴的温度为60℃-70℃,更加优选的恒温水浴的温度为65℃)。
上述一种具有促进伤口愈合功效的医用敷料的制备方法,优选的方案是,步骤(4)中所述消泡剂为质量分数为0.12%-0.20%的聚醚F68(优选的所述消泡剂为质量分数为0.14%-0.18%的聚醚F68,更加优选的所述消泡剂为质量分数为0.16%的聚醚F68)。
上述一种具有促进伤口愈合功效的医用敷料的制备方法,优选的方案是,步骤(4)中所述抗菌剂为质量分数为3.1%-3.7%的超微TiO2粉(优选的所述抗菌剂为质量分数为3.3%-3.5%的超微TiO2粉,更加优选的所述抗菌剂为质量分数为3.4%的超微TiO2粉)。
上述一种具有促进伤口愈合功效的医用敷料的制备方法,优选的方案是,步骤(4)中所述透皮吸收剂为质量分数为1%-3%的薄荷醇(优选的所述透皮吸收剂为质量分数为1.5%-2.5%的薄荷醇,更加优选的所述透皮吸收剂为质量分数为2%的薄荷醇)。
各主要原料的药理功效或理化性质分别为:
聚氨酯:全称为聚氨基甲酸酯,是主链上含有重复氨基甲酸酯基团的大分子化合物的统称。它是由有机二异氰酸酯或多异氰酸酯与二羟基或多羟基化合物加聚而成。聚氨酯的力学性能具有很大的可调性。通过控制结晶的硬段和不结晶的软段之间的比例,聚氨酯可以获得不同的力学性能。因此其制品具有耐磨、耐温、密封、隔音、加工性能好、可降解等优异性能。医用聚氨酯材料具有优良的生物相容性、可黏合性和抗血栓性,同时还具有优良的力学性能,在医用生物材料中扮演了十分重要的角色。
骨碎补:基原:为水龙骨科植物槲蕨、中华槲蕨、石莲姜槲蕨、崖姜、光亮密网蕨以及骨碎补科植物大叶骨碎补、海州骨碎补等的根茎。化学成份:槲蕨根茎含淀粉16.4%、葡萄糖5.37%,还含柚皮甙。性味:苦,温。归经:入肝、肾经。功能主治:补肾,活血,止血。治肾虚久泻及腰痛,风湿痹痛,齿痛,耳鸣,跌打闪挫、骨伤,阑尾炎,斑秃,鸡眼。
黄芪:基原:本品为豆科植物蒙古黄芪或膜荚黄芪的干燥根。性味:甘,温。归经:归肺、脾经。功效:补气固表,利尿托毒,排脓,敛疮生肌。主治:用于气虚乏力,食少便溏,中气下陷,久泻脱肛,便血崩漏,表虚自汗,气虚水肿,痈疽难溃,久溃不敛,血虚痿黄,内热消渴;慢性肾炎蛋白尿,糖尿病。
岩笋:基原:为兰科植物笋兰的全草。性味:甘;平。归经:肺;胃;肾经。功能主治:止咳平喘;活血祛瘀;接骨。主肺热喘咳;胃脘痛;跌打损伤;骨折。
细辛:基原:本品为马兜铃科植物北细辛、汉城细辛或华细辛的根及根茎。化学成份:辽细辛含挥发油约3%,挥发油的主要成分是甲基丁香油酚,其他有黄樟醚、β-蒎烯、优葛缕酮、酚性物质等。性味:辛,温。归经:归心、肺、肾经。药理作用:①局部麻醉作用,②解热、镇痛作用,③抑菌作用。功效:祛风散寒,通窍止痛,温肺化饮。主治:用于风寒感冒,头痛,牙痛。鼻塞鼻渊,风湿痹痛,痰饮喘咳。
甘草:基原:本品为豆科植物甘草、胀果甘草或光果甘草的干燥根及根茎。性味:甘,平。归经:归心。肺、脾、胃经。功效:补脾益气,清热解毒,祛痰止咳,缓急止痛,调和诸药。主治:用于脾胃虚弱,倦怠乏力,心悸气短,咳嗽痰多,院腹、四肢挛急疼痛,痈肿疮毒,缓解药物毒性、烈性。
陆英:基原:为忍冬科植物陆英的茎叶。化学成份:陆英全草含黄酮类、酚性成分、鞣质、糖类、绿原酸,种子含氰甙类。药理作用:1。镇痛:陆英煎剂70、120、140g/kg灌服,对小鼠热板法试验表明有镇痛作用,其镇痛成分体内半衰期为3.9h。2。抗肝损伤:陆英成分熊果酸100mg/kg皮下注射,对大鼠实验性肝损伤有保护作用,使肝中甘油三酯含量减少,并减轻肝细胞变性及坏死。3。其他作用:煎剂5g/kg灌胃,并加酒调外敷,对实验性骨折兔,有活血散瘀、增加磷的吸收、促进骨痂骨化的作用。性味:味甘;微苦;性平。功能主治:祛风;利湿;舒筋;活血。主风温痹痛;腰腿痛;水肿;黄疸;跌打扣损伤;产后恶露不行;风疹瘙痒;丹毒;疮肿。
虎杖:基原:为蓼科植物虎杖的根茎。化学成份:根和根茎含游离葸醌及蒽醌甙。主要为大黄素、大黄素甲醚和大黄酚,以及蒽甙A、蒽甙B。根中还含3,4’,5-三羟基芪-3-β-D-葡萄糖甙。另含鞣质和几种多糖。药理作用:①抗菌作用;②抗病毒作用。性味:苦,平。归经:肝;胆经。功能主治:活血散瘀;祛风通络;清热利湿;解毒。主妇女经闭;痛经;产后恶露不下;症瘕积聚;跌扑损伤;风湿痹痛;湿热黄疸;淋浊带下;疮疡肿毒;毒蛇咬伤;水火烫伤。
积雪草:基原:为双子叶植物伞形科积雪草的干燥全草或带根全草。成分:含多种α-香树脂醇型的三萜成分,其中有积雪草苷、参枯尼苷、异参枯尼苷,羟基积雪草苷,玻热模苷、破热米苷和破热米酸等,以及马达积雪草酸。药性:苦、辛,寒。归肝、脾、肾经。功用主治:清热解毒,利湿消肿。是东方人的长寿药,可益脑提神。研究表明具有滋补、消炎、愈合伤口、利尿通便和镇定作用。对麻风病、溃疡也有疗效,对血液净化及免疫力有激活作用,因其可刺激深层皮肤细胞的更替。它是神经滋补剂,能提高记忆力,减轻精神疲劳;还可降血压,治疗肝病等。
川芎:基原:本品为伞形科植物川穹的干燥根茎。性状:本品为不规则结节状拳形团块。表面黄褐色,粗糙皱缩,有多数平行隆起的轮节,顶端有凹陷的类圆形茎痕,下侧及轮节上有多数小瘤状根痕。质坚实,不易折断,断面黄白色或灰黄色,散有黄棕色的油室,形成层环呈波状。性味:辛,温。归经:归肝、胆、心包经。功效:活血行气,祛风止痛。主治:用于月经不调.经闭痛经,癥瘕腹痛,胸胁刺痛,跌扑肿痛,头痛。风湿痹痛。
荆芥:基原:为唇形科植物荆芥的全草。化学成份:含挥发油1。8%,油中主成分为右旋薄荷酮、消旋簿荷酮、少量右旋柠檬烯。药理作用:用人工发热的家兔,口服荆芥煎剂与浸剂2克(生药)/公斤,无甚解热作用。在体外,高浓度(1:100)有抗结核杆菌之作用。性味:辛,温。归经:入肺、肝经。功能主治:发表,祛风,理血;炒炭止血。治感冒发热,头痛,咽喉肿痛,中风口噤,吐血,衄血,便血;崩漏,产后血晕;痈肿,疮疥,瘰疬。荆芥穗效用相同,惟发散之力较强。
聚乙烯醇:白色片状、絮状或粉末状固体,无味。对人体皮肤无刺激性。PVA是唯一可被细菌作为碳源和能源利用的乙烯基聚合物,在细菌和酶的作用下,46天可降解75%,属于一种生物可降解高分子材料,可由非石油路线大规模生产,价格低廉,其耐油、耐溶剂及气体阻隔性能出众,在食品、药品包装方面具有独特优势。
醋酸淀粉酯:为白色粉末;特点是糊的凝沉性低,对酸、碱、热的稳定性高,糊的透明度高,冻溶稳定性好。主要用途:增稠剂、稳定剂、黏结剂、制食用淀粉膜。分子间不易形成氢键。低取代度的淀粉醋酸酯含乙酰0.5%-2.5%,在食品加工中用作增稠剂,其优点是黏度高,澄明度高,凝沉性弱,储存稳定。常将其进行复合变性,交联淀粉醋酸酯对于高温、强剪切力和低pH影响具有更高黏度稳定性,低温储存和冻融稳定性也高,适于罐头类食品应用,能在不同温度下储存。羟丙基淀粉醋酸酯,羟丙基取代度约3~6,乙酰基取代度约0.5~0.9,为口香糖的好基质,不溶于水,口嚼弹性好。

实施例1一种具有促进伤口愈合功效的医用敷料,由下列主要原料制备而成,均为重量份(45g/份):聚氨酯25份;骨碎补4份;黄芪5份;岩笋6份;细辛6份;甘草10份;陆英8份;虎杖7份;积雪草5份;川芎6份;荆芥10份;聚乙烯醇9份;醋酸淀粉酯6份。
一种具有促进伤口愈合功效的医用敷料的制备方法是:
(1)将虎杖、骨碎补和细辛置于容器中,加入3.8倍所述原料药量的白酒浸泡3天,每天摇动2次,过滤,滤液回收乙醇,得药液,备用;
(2)将步骤(1)所得药渣与黄芪、岩笋、甘草、陆英、积雪草、川芎和荆芥混合,置于药锅内,加二次蒸馏水,文火煎煮两次,第一次煎煮33分钟,第二次煎煮20分钟,合并两次煎液,过滤,滤液与步骤(1)所得药液混合,减压浓缩至75℃相对密度为1.18-1.20的清膏,加入香油拌匀,制成中药油膏,备用;
(3)将聚氨酯溶于DMF中配制成浓度为20%的聚氨酯溶液,置于三颈瓶中,向溶液中加入聚乙烯醇和醋酸淀粉酯,于50℃恒温水浴锅中,沿顺时针磁力搅拌1小时,得混合溶液,备用;
(4)向步骤(3)所得混合溶液中加入步骤(2)所得中药油膏、消泡剂(所述消泡剂为质量分数为0.12%的聚醚F68)、抗菌剂(所述抗菌剂为质量分数为3.1%的超微TiO2粉)及透皮吸收剂(所述透皮吸收剂为质量分数为1%的薄荷醇),混匀,得铸膜液,备用;
(5)将步骤(4)所得铸膜液倒入平板玻璃板上,均匀刮制成膜,静置8分钟,然后平行放入清水中凝胶45分钟,取出,置于浓度为0.2%羟丙甲基纤维素水溶液中浸泡10分钟,取出,冷冻干燥,灭菌,封装,即得。
本发明所得医用敷料的使用方法是:将患处用温水擦拭干净,取适量大小的敷料贴合在患处,一天更换一次。
典型案例一:周XX,男,30岁,菏泽人。患者2012年8月17日左小腿以外被碰伤后出现一拇指大小的伤口,有血流出,疼痛剧烈。在附近诊所治疗后,伤口逐渐结痂,因结痂处痒痛难忍,患者多次抓挠导致痂皮掉落,三日后患处伤口周围皮肤溃烂,逐渐扩大,在当地某医院经抗生素治疗后,伤口未完全愈合。后经人介绍于2012年9月30日来我院就诊。检查:患处可见一5×5cm大小的环形溃疡,中间有黑色血痂和出血,溃疡边界清楚,上缘有增生,周围皮肤红肿。经患者同意使用本实施例所得一种具有促进伤口愈合功效的医用敷料贴合于患处,每天更换一次。治疗五天后,患者患处干燥,无出血症状,周围皮肤颜色基本恢复正常,继续治疗三天后,患者伤口无黑色血痂,创面干燥,无红肿,无疼痛症状。用药期间患者无其他不适反应。

试验例1:本发明所得一种具有促进伤口愈合功效的医用敷料(实施例5)的降解性能试验:
取面积为5×5cm2的本发明所得一种具有促进伤口愈合功效的医用辅料置于pH为7.4的PBS缓冲溶液中,培养7周,每周取出,水洗、干燥,称重。计算降解率。公式如下:DR(%)=(W1-W2)/W1×100,其中,W1为降解前样品质量,W2为降解后样品质量。结果如图1所示。
由图1数据可知,本发明所得一种具有促进伤口愈合功效的医用辅料在开始的1-2周内降解速率较缓慢,在3周后其降解率明显增加达到15%,此后降解率逐渐加快,到第7周时其降解率接近70%。
试验例2:本发明所得一种具有促进伤口愈合功效的医用敷料(实施例5)的应用研究:
选取2012年5月-2014年5月来我院治疗的300例患者,其中男性178例,女性122例,年龄最大67岁,年龄最小9岁。所有患者皮肤均有不同程度的创伤,其中机械性损伤患者158例,疾病感染损伤患者93例,烧烫伤患者49例。所有患者随机分为实验组和对照组,两组患者在年龄、病情等方面差异无统计学意义(P>0.05),具有可比性。其中实验组使用本发明所得一种具有促进伤口愈合功效的医用敷料,使用方法:将患处用温水擦拭干净,取适量大小的敷料贴合在患处,一天更换一次。对照组使用无菌敷贴(厂商:青岛海氏海诺医疗用品有限公司)。共观察治疗7天。疗效评定标准:痊愈:创口完全愈合;显效:创口基本愈合或结痂;有效:创口明显缩小,炎症等表现减轻;无效:创口没有明显的改善或加重。总有效率=(痊愈例数+显效例数+有效例数)/总观察病例数×100%。结果如表1所示。
表1实验组和对照组患者的治疗效果
由表1数据可知,使用本发明所得一种具有促进伤口愈合功效的医用敷料的实验组痊愈122例(67.8%),显效39例(21.7%),有效15例(8.3%),无效4例(2.2%),总有效率为97.8%。而对照组的痊愈率为47.5%,总有效率仅79.2%。由此表明,本发明所得医用敷料具有显效快,治愈率高的显著效果。
